Born on July 22, 1992, in Grand Prairie, Texas, Selena Marie Gomez embarked on her entertainment career at a young age. Her early role as Gianna on "Barney & Friends" ignited a passion for performing, setting the stage for a remarkable trajectory. The Disney Channel series "Wizards of Waverly Place," where she portrayed Alex Russo, catapulted her to teen idol status. This success opened doors to a multifaceted career encompassing music, film, and television. However, Gomez's journey hasn't been solely marked by triumphs. Her very public struggles with lupus, a chronic autoimmune disease, and her candid discussions about mental health have resonated deeply with fans, fostering a sense of connection and inspiring open conversations about these often-stigmatized topics. Beyond her artistic pursuits, Gomez has demonstrated a keen business acumen. Her beauty brand, Rare Beauty, emphasizes inclusivity and promotes mental well-being, aligning with her personal values. This venture underscores her evolution from a child star to a multi-hyphenate powerhouse.
Full Name: | Selena Marie Gomez |
Date of Birth: | July 22, 1992 |
Place of Birth: | Grand Prairie, Texas, USA |
Occupation: | Singer, Actress, Producer, Entrepreneur |
Parents: | Mandy Teefey and Ricardo Joel Gomez |
Notable Works: | "Wizards of Waverly Place", "Only Murders in the Building", Albums: "Stars Dance", "Revival", "Rare" |
Brand: | Rare Beauty |

In recent years, Gomez has taken on more mature roles, showcasing her versatility as an actress. Her starring role in the Hulu series "Only Murders in the Building" alongside comedic legends Steve Martin and Martin Short cemented her status as a formidable talent in the world of television. This darkly comedic mystery series allowed her to demonstrate her comedic timing and dramatic depth, earning critical acclaim and captivating audiences. The incident involving Sam Parker, a Republican senate candidate, highlights the complexities of fame in the digital age. Parker's tweet calling for Gomez's deportation, although later deleted, sparked a heated debate about online harassment and political grandstanding. Gomez's measured response, thanking him for the "laugh and the threat," showcased her ability to disarm negativity with wit and grace. This episode underscored the importance of using social media responsibly and the ongoing need to address online hate speech.
